Palash Sen addresses trolling after his put up on Atif Aslam: ‘I used to be pointing to many extra issues…’

Singer Palash Sen is understood for his contribution to Hindi unbiased music with songs like Meri, Mehfooz, Dhoom and plenty of extra. While typically sustaining a low profile as a public determine, the singer lately got here below the radar of trolls for posting an appreciation put up for Pakistani singer Atif Aslam, who could be very standard in Bollywood. Palash in his put up lauded Atif for his contribution to Hindi music and stated that his singing model continues to be copied by many music administrators. Though her phrases of reward weren’t taken in good spirit by the trolls, the singer clarified that her put up was misunderstood.

Palash had posted an outdated image with Atif on his Instagram and captioned it as, “According to me, the one singer-composer who has made the biggest impact on Bollywood music and most singers in the last 15 years is this guy Amazing @atifaslam. I am saying this with great humility. He has the style, the panache and that nose flair that most Bollywood singers tried to emulate. And his music is still sung by some of the leading music directors. Copied.. Minor Chord Kings!! This picture is from 10 years old, when we both collaborated for our concert in Abu Dhabi. And both Indian and Pakistani both sang and danced together. Music united!! “

Trollers attacked Palash for praising a singer from throughout the border. One consumer wrote, ‘He ought to have made extra impression in his personal nation. We have much better singers than them (sic).” While another posted, “In the identify of artwork it is bollywood for you, they all the time help Pakistan (sic).”

In an interview with Hindustan Times, Palash clarified, “Usually, I don’t get trolled because I have always been below the radar. I am a small player in the bigger scheme of things, especially because I do not belong to Bollywood. I am a self-funded independent artist, supported by none other than the people of India. I don’t think people really understood the gist of my post, because there were layers to it. Apart from supporting Atif, I was alluding to many other things.”

He continued, “My question was very basic: do we really lack the talent that a musician had such an impact on Bollywood? I think Atif made a huge impact, so Bollywood forgot our own talent and Everyone started following his way of singing/making music.”

Palash additionally stated that Indians needs to be given alternatives in different international locations as nicely.

“We being Indians, give so many alternatives to everybody, however I do not assume we get the identical reciprocity from different international locations. If individuals ultimately perceive my function and begin asking huge questions, then there isn’t any level in trolling me. No objections,” he stated.
